Tue Dec 10 10:10:00 UTC 2024: ## Two-Alarm Fire Destroys Manchester Home; One Escapes Safely
**Manchester, NH** – A two-alarm fire completely destroyed a two-family home on the corner of Notre Dame Avenue and Putnam Street in Manchester Monday morning. One person, a tenant on the first floor, escaped the blaze unharmed.
The fire, which broke out around 7:15 a.m., was reported by the first-floor tenant to the homeowners, Hilary and Marc Laquerre. Flames were seen shooting from the second-story windows, and firefighters described the fire as concentrated in the attic and knee walls, presenting a significant challenge. A two-alarm response was initiated, requiring all available firefighters.
The Laquerres, who purchased the property two months ago and were nearing completion of renovations to prepare it for rental, described the situation as “surreal.” The upstairs apartment was vacant at the time of the fire. Firefighters confirmed the home is a total loss. The cause of the fire remains under investigation. Streets surrounding the home, near Catholic Medical Center, were temporarily closed while crews battled the blaze.
